Kiln saggers are specialized containers designed to support and protect ceramic pieces during the firing process. Made from materials capable of withstanding high temperatures, kiln saggers help prevent warping or damage to pottery that might occur during firing.
Traditional supports refer to any standard item used to hold ceramics during firing, such as kiln posts and shelves. These items are often made from less specialized materials, and while they can work, they may not provide the best protection for your artwork.
While kiln saggers may initially seem more expensive, consider their potential to improve the quality of your work. When ceramics are less likely to be damaged, the investment can pay off in better outcomes and fewer replacements.

If you're dealing with intricate or delicate pieces, kiln saggers are highly recommended. They are also a great choice for high-heat firings or when you want to ensure the best possible results from your kiln. If you’re producing ceramics in bulk, the enhanced stability can save time and resources in the long run.
While kiln saggers offer a lot of benefits, they do come with a few considerations. They may require more storage space and can be a bit heavier than traditional supports. Additionally, they might necessitate a higher initial investment. However, for many, the benefits overshadow these downsides.
In summary, while both kiln saggers and traditional supports have their place in pottery firing, kiln saggers provide a level of protection and heat control that traditional supports may lack. The choice ultimately depends on your specific needs and the type of ceramics you are creating. If quality and durability are top priorities, kiln saggers could be the more effective option for you.
